What is 1.96 billion in scientific notation?

A. 1.96 109
B. 1.96 106
C. 1.96 1012
D. 1.96 1015

a billion is 9 zeroes
1.96 is already less than 10 and greater than or equal to 1 so

1.96 times 10^9 is answer

A is answer
